历经艰辛找到工作,却发现嵌入式开发岗位隐藏着许多求职者不知晓的秘密。像我这样的初学者,想要踏入这个领域并找到一份满意的工作,其中的艰辛和感慨真是难以言表。
对嵌入式开发岗的初步认知
起初,我对嵌入式开发岗位的了解仅是模糊的轮廓,本科阶段虽稍有涉猎,但也仅限于单片机和C语言基础。在很多人看来,大学里学的C语言知识并不丰富。2018年年初,当我开始自学时,就像在茫茫黑夜中摸索前行,既看不清前方道路,又面临着重重困难。这种从零开始的状态,正是众多想要投身嵌入式开发岗位的新手们共同面临的起点。一开始,搜集和筛选资料就变得尤为艰难,因为市面上充斥着大量质量不一的内容。
在探索的过程中,我渐渐认识到,从事嵌入式开发工作,不仅需要坚实的C语言基础,还得掌握众多硬件领域的知识。这个岗位的魅力在于,从编写底层代码到与硬件进行交互,每一个环节都充满了挑战。
自学之路的曲折与转机
自学之路颇为不易,起初我买了某培训机构的C语言基础视频,但感觉收获不大。后来,实验室里的前辈推荐了另一套视频,犹如黑暗中指引的明灯。从3月到7月,我日复一日地学习,8月开始着手做项目,月底便投入了校园招聘的准备。在这期间,挑选合适的视频资料起到了至关重要的作用。
自学不能随意跟风购买各类教材,真正适合自己的才是关键。首先,要清楚自己的知识基础和接受程度。许多人误以为资料越多越好,于是买了一大堆,却并未真正掌握。
嵌入式学习资料的选择
众多学习资料中,有些特别实用。比如韦东山编写的嵌入式路线图,尤其是对嵌入式系统理解的部分,仅用几页就能清晰易懂地展示整个系统开发过程。这对嵌入式开发岗位的求职者来说,意义重大,因为在面试中,系统相关的问题常常会被问到。
另外,观看免费的入门教程也是个不错的选择。这样做不仅能更深入地理解嵌入式开发,还能判断这些视频是否适合自己的学习需求。众多优质的免费视频里,很可能就包含了入门阶段必须掌握的知识点。
嵌入式相关面试要点
寻找嵌入式开发职位,面试是必经之路。笔试阶段,C语言是主要考察内容,这就需要我们深入了解库函数等编程要点。面试时,从简历制作到问题回答,都有一定的技巧。简历中应突出项目经验和专业技能。无论是技术面试还是HR面试,提前准备一个条理清晰的自我介绍,迅速展示自己的优势,这一点至关重要。
面试官真正看重的是应聘者的分析和问题解决能力。在回答关于自我定位或对系统理解的问题时,若能给出出色的答案,便能获得加分。就拿我面试的经历来说,对岗位的认知回答得恰当,常常能令面试官眼前一亮。
长期积累的重要性
学习嵌入式开发并非短时间内就能完成的事情。从最初接触这门技术到最终找到工作,我投入了大量的时间。从大学本科阶段的基础学习,到自学过程中的坚持不懈,每一步都积累了宝贵的经验。人们常常急于求成,然而嵌入式开发技术却只青睐那些心态平和、稳重的人。
在这个行业里,我们必须遵守一个原则,那就是要持之以恒地学习,不断进步。我们要在学习的同时,动手实践项目,通过实践来提升自己的能力。不论是否加入了培训班,是否有导师的指导,都不能忽视积累的重要性。
求职者的未来展望
求职嵌入式开发岗位的人士,在学习和求职的准备阶段,必须制定个人计划。这包括提前根据招聘要求调整学习方向。展望未来,这一岗位蕴藏着巨大的发展空间,只要付出努力,前景广阔。
你是否也在为嵌入式开发岗位勤奋学习?让我们大家踊跃点赞,积极分享,并在评论区交流彼此的经验。